Arquimedes

Conventional price banks in FIEBDC-3 format Work with parametric price banks (including those compiled in DLLs), with multiple prices (prices for labour, materials, etc.), and with specifications (if the price bank you are working with includes them). Includes a dictionary to quickly locate concepts based on key terms. Associates graphics to items, work sections and unit prices. Specifications of conventional price banks in FIEBDC-3 format

Flat shells

 Shells are flat two-dimensional elements with constant thickness and without openings, whose perimeter is defined by a polygon. They are entered and analysed in CYPE 3D and can be made of concrete, rolled steel, cold-formed steel, aluminium or generic material (specifying the modulus of elasticity and Poisson's ratio).
